黑马程序员技术交流社区

标题: 新手学Eclipse的困惑 [打印本页]

作者: 编程学徙    时间: 2014-6-18 10:20
标题: 新手学Eclipse的困惑
本帖最后由 编程学徙 于 2014-6-20 00:25 编辑

  1. /**
  2. 接口与多态的综合练习
  3. 接口:提高了代码的扩展性。
  4. 多态:提高了代码的利用性。
  5. */


  6. class MainBoard
  7. {
  8.         public void run()
  9.         {
  10.                 System.out.println("Mainboard run");
  11.         }
  12.         public void usePCI(PCI p)                        //当调用此方法,且对象不为空时,则运行该对象所属类的对应open方法和close方法。
  13.         {
  14.                 if(p!=null)
  15.                 {
  16.                         p.open();
  17.                         p.close();
  18.                 }
  19.         }                                                        
  20. }
  21. interface PCI
  22. {
  23.         public void open();
  24.         public void close();
  25. }
  26. class NetCard implements PCI
  27. {
  28.         public void open()
  29.         {
  30.                 System.out.println("NetCard open");
  31.         }
  32.         public void close()
  33.         {
  34.                 System.out.println("NetCard close");
  35.         }
  36. }
  37. class SoundCard implements PCI
  38. {
  39.         public void open()
  40.         {
  41.                 System.out.println("SoundCard open");
  42.         }
  43.         public void close()
  44.         {
  45.                 System.out.println("SoundCard close");
  46.         }
  47. }
  48. public class DuoTaiDemo3
  49. {
  50.         public static void main(String[] args)
  51.         {
  52.                 MainBoard m = new MainBoard();
  53.                 m.run();
  54.                 m.usePCI(new NetCard());
  55.                 m.usePCI(new SoundCard());
  56.                 m.usePCI(null);
  57.         }
  58. }
复制代码

以上是练习代码。同样是这段代码,在CMD里运行,是可以的。。



可是,在Eclipse里,却提示了一堆的错误,而我的英文水准又实在是差了点……




这到底是为什么啊?
补充:已解决,源文件名写得不对,谢谢大家的解答。。。







作者: 黎志勇    时间: 2014-6-18 10:27
我这边没问题啊。你是不是没在Eclipse里面把源文件名给改成 DuoTaiDemo3.java
作者: 会说话的木头    时间: 2014-6-18 10:56
没有导包!
作者: BigKarel    时间: 2014-6-18 10:59
eclipse配置问题
作者: 编程学徙    时间: 2014-6-18 11:38
会说话的木头 发表于 2014-6-18 10:56
没有导包!

如何导入包?
作者: 编程学徙    时间: 2014-6-18 11:44
BigKarel 发表于 2014-6-18 10:59
eclipse配置问题

求详解,如何配置?
作者: BigKarel    时间: 2014-6-18 12:20
编程学徙 发表于 2014-6-18 11:44
求详解,如何配置?

出现找不到类的问题一般是你缺失导入的包,是JRE的问题,把你的项目目录截个图,还有右键项目点classpath也截个图吧




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2